Muffuletta Dip Recipe

Ingredients with Measurements:
- 2 cups of chopped black olives
- 1 cup of chopped green olives
- 1 cup of chopped artichoke hearts
- 1/2 cup of diced red onion
- 1/2 cup of diced celery
- 1/2 cup of diced red bell pepper
- 1/4 cup of capers
- 1/4 cup of olive oil
- 2 tablespoons of red wine vinegar
- 1 teaspoon of dried oregano
- 1 teaspoon of dried basil
- 1/2 teaspoon of garlic powder
- 1/2 teaspoon of onion powder
- 1/4 teaspoon of red pepper flakes
- Salt and pepper to taste

Special Equipment Needed:
- Cutting board
- Knife
- Measuring cups
- Measuring spoons
- Mixing bowl

Step-by-Step Instructions:
1. Chop the black olives, green olives, artichoke hearts, red onion, celery, and red bell pepper and place in a mixing bowl.
2. Add the capers, olive oil, red wine vinegar, oregano, basil, garlic powder, onion powder, red pepper flakes, salt, and pepper to the bowl and mix until combined.
3. Cover and refrigerate for at least 1 hour before serving.

Food History:
Muffuletta dip is a variation of the classic Italian sandwich, the Muffuletta. The sandwich was created in the early 1900s by Italian immigrants in New Orleans and is traditionally made with a variety of Italian meats, cheeses, and olive salad.

Flavor Profiles:
Muffuletta dip has a savory and tangy flavor from the olives, capers, and red wine vinegar. It is also slightly spicy from the red pepper flakes.
